Output 85a8d6f1ef3680ef904013b2bc833455127f29a6734ab0eb9db31d90aeff2a89:0

value
29803
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83ca626014a77e16d52280730d45dfb36c5cb5cd OP_EQUALVERIFY OP_CHECKSIG
address
1D1qy363YbzzvXexvSpeFPfxGBstSvbpBd
transaction
85a8d6f1ef3680ef904013b2bc833455127f29a6734ab0eb9db31d90aeff2a89
confirmations
280203
spent
true